rentals: Rents are DOWN on Oahui!!!!! - 06/15/08 06:11 AM
                 
Supply of Rentals is UP!  Rents are coming Down in Hawaii!   Well, a little bit!!!  
Most of us in the property management business have recently recognized that the market has softened and that we are not getting the number of qualified tenants applying for a rental to which we have grown accustomed over the past several years.   Mostly, we have attributed it to home owners who, being unable to roll their investment homes quickly, have put them on the rental market.  But there may be more to this than meets the eye of the casual observer.
